We are looking to recruit a Facilities Manager for our site in South Westminster. The site is one of our most important resources and enables us to provide accommodation for up to 39 young people as well as excellent services to homeless children, families and young people.
This is an exciting and varied role in our Central Services team that will partner closely with the Director of Finance and Operations. You will be responsible for delivering a safe and secure living environment for the young people in our Hostel and Supported living accommodation as well as ensuring that our offices are maintained to a high standard and provide a place of welcome to our clients. You will also act as the organisation’s health and safety officer and manage a budget of approximately £250k for facilities management.
